Output 8bf498fed657cbc45929227a6e4687597f4b2e1dc8e6ea22ffd7e1bbc662e765:1

value
107569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686417852852a658a909485c7dcb27303213cf55 OP_EQUAL
address
3BCz6zvkRNtSwzHiAJ594KQmociCXE2rBv
transaction
8bf498fed657cbc45929227a6e4687597f4b2e1dc8e6ea22ffd7e1bbc662e765
spent
true